What is Crypto Mining?

The process of crypto mining is using computer hardware to solve hard math tasks. Verifying cryptocurrency transactions, which are then added to the blockchain, a public record, is hard because of these problems. This complicated process is like a global race, with miners trying to answer problems as fast as they can. The winner adds the next block to the chain.

Miners are given cryptocurrency as a reward for their work, which encourages more people to join this important part of the cryptocurrency economy. The network is safer and more stable the more miners there are.

How is Crypto Mining Done?

At its core, crypto mining is about finding ways to solve problems. Miners solve hard math problems with specialized gear, like powerful graphics processing units (GPUs) or application-specific integrated circuits (ASICs). These problems are about a block of events and have to do with cryptographic hash functions. The goal is to find a specific number that, when hashed, gives a result within a certain range.

But it’s not as easy as putting in a computer and getting results. It is a tough process. Think of it as a race around the world: the first miner to solve the problem gets to add the transaction block to the blockchain. The miner is then given a set amount of cryptocurrency, like Bitcoin or Ethereum, as a prize. This process is also called “proof of work,” which is a consensus method that makes sure other people on the network agree with the transactions.

But the difficulty of these tasks changes over time so that there is a steady flow of new blocks and the market doesn’t get too full. The challenge goes up as more miners join the network, making it harder to mine. This makes sure that a cryptocurrency’s total amount is given out slowly over time instead of all at once. It’s a tricky balancing act to stop inflation while still giving miners money for the important work they do to keep and grow the blockchain network.

What are the Benefits of Crypto Mining?

There are several benefits of crypto mining, one can even write a book on these benefits, but without wasting a lot of your time, I’ve penned down these benefits in brief.

  1. Miners receive a reward in the form of cryptocurrency for successfully mining a block.
  2. Crypto mining can be a profitable activity, depending on factors such as hardware efficiency, electricity costs, and the market value of the mined cryptocurrency.
  3. Crypto mining contributes to the security of the blockchain network by verifying transactions and preventing fraud.
  4. It helps maintain a decentralized system, promoting fairness and preventing the control of the network by a single entity.
  5. Miners play a role in the introduction of new coins into the cryptocurrency ecosystem, controlling inflation.
  6. Mining offers a way for individuals to become part of the cryptocurrency community, contributing to its growth and evolution.
  7. Successful miners have the potential to influence the direction and future developments of the cryptocurrency they mine.
